Above you will find a diagram of the schematic for our garden. (I made it in AppleWorks and the original file has grid lines that make it easy to pinpoint exactly where each plant should be placed.) The plot is 4m x 9m. The sizes of the circles are based on the (within row) spacing suggested for each plant on its seed packet. Thus, this approximates the amount of space needed for each plant. (The zucchini and Brandywine circles are 90 cm, or about 3′.)

Doc B is Back
Doc B finally has his home email back. Didn’t see the Vince Young show in Pasadena but seems like he’s a hot commodity. He goes #3 to the Titans. They already have the original linebacker-sized QB, Air McNair (who can throw the rock with anyone), so they should be able to fit the new kid in. Bush goes #1 — no way Texans give up on their QB at this point with this guy available. Leinart goes #2 to the Aints. They just hired a QB coach as they new HC and there’s no way a QB coach passes over a classic drop-back game manager for an athletic guy with an iffy arm like Young. Jets new HC takes Ferguson. Stud OT is safe pick when you know that the team is at least a couple few years away from competing. I saw where the Pack, at #5, are in love with young LenDale. Only problem is he was barely in anyone’s top 20 three weeks ago. Do they reach and hope every Sunday will be a new Rose Bowl or do they risk trading down? More likely the former, as the hype machine gets cranked up. Big mistake is leaking that you got yer eyes on a guy who should normally go much lower than yer pick. Skins did it last year with that Auburn QB and had to scramble to get him in the end.
